Tomcat在CentOS中的故障排查步骤是什么
Tomcat在CentOS中的故障排查步骤如下:
- 查看日志文件:检查
TOMCAT_HOME/logs
目录下的catalina.out
、localhost.log
等,定位错误信息。 - 检查Java环境:确认Java已安装且版本正确,设置
JAVA_HOME
环境变量。 - 验证配置文件:检查
server.xml
、context.xml
等配置文件的端口、路径等是否正确。 - 处理端口冲突:用
netstat -tuln | grep 端口号
查看端口占用情况,停止冲突进程或修改Tomcat端口。 - 检查系统资源:通过
top
、free -m
、df -h
等命令确保内存、磁盘空间、CPU充足。 - 调整防火墙/SELinux:开放Tomcat端口(如8080),临时禁用SELinux排查权限问题。
- 确认文件权限:确保Tomcat目录及文件权限正确,避免因权限不足导致启动失败。
- 重启服务:修改配置后,执行
systemctl daemon-reload
并重启Tomcat。 - 分析性能问题:若存在性能瓶颈,可通过监控工具(如
jconsole
)分析线程池、内存使用情况。
若以上步骤无法解决,可参考日志中的详细错误信息进一步排查,或寻求社区支持。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权请联系我们,一经查实立即删除!